The TRI DATU bracelet in Bainese culture
The Tri Datu bracelet isn’t just a souvenir — it carries deep meaning in Balinese culture. The red, white, and black threads represent creation, protection, and transformation, reminding us to stay balanced through life’s changes. 🌺✨
